LANGTON LONG BLANDFORD - ST 90 NW 3/5 The Old Stables (formerly listed as 26.6.53 outbuildings and stables.) GV II Stable block, now partly converted into a dwelling, 1832. By C R Cockrell. Ashlar with hipped slate roofs and deeply overhanging eaves to the internal courtyard. North and south round arched courtyard entrances with open pediments. Octagonal plan. 2 storeys. External walls have lunette windows under round relieving arches. Internal walls have 30-pane pivoting windows. Upper floor windows mostly blind. First floor plat band. Plain plank doors. Over the north pediment is a clock turret with cupola. (RCHM, Dorset, vol.IV, p.44, no.2. Newman, J and Pevsner, N. The Buildings of England: Dorset, 1972, p.250/1.) Listing NGR: ST9026605620
